What is an organisation identifier?
An organisation identifier is a unique piece of text that definitively identifies an organisation.
Examples include charity numbers and company numbers.
Identifiers are usually assigned by an external body like a regulator.
Findthatcharity uses the Org ID scheme to create identifiers.
GB-NIC gives the scheme for this identifier (The Charity Commission for Northern Ireland), while 103179 is the identifier for this organisation within the scheme.
Description
The Rock Community Association is established: to advance citizenship or community development, to advance health and to advance arts and culture and heritage for the inhabitants of Rock and its surrounding areas (area of benefit) in particular by: a) Providing recreational facilities for the community. b) Facilitating capacity building through support, mentoring and advice, education, training both individual and group.Provide education, training, personal, group development and related consultancy services; 2) To advance any other exclusively charitable purpose as the committee may, from time to time, decide in accordance with the law of charity in Northern Ireland.
